/** * Constraint-Aware Validation System * Validates operations against actual database constraints before execution * Prevents the constraint violations identified in beta testing */ import type { createClient } from '@supabase/supabase-js'; import { SchemaIntrospectionResult } from '../../schema/schema-introspector'; type SupabaseClient = ReturnType<typeof createClient>; export interface ValidationRule { id: string; name: string; description: string; table: string; column?: string; type: 'not_null' | 'unique' | 'foreign_key' | 'check' | 'custom' | 'business_logic'; severity: 'error' | 'warning' | 'info'; sqlCheck: string; parameters: string[]; errorMessage: string; autoFix?: { possible: boolean; strategy: 'provide_default' | 'skip_field' | 'modify_value' | 'create_dependency'; fixValue?: any; }; } export interface ValidationContext { operation: 'insert' | 'update' | 'delete'; table: string; data: Record<string, any>; userId?: string; existingData?: Record<string, any>; schemaInfo: SchemaIntrospectionResult; } export interface ValidationResult { valid: boolean; errors: ValidationError[]; warnings: ValidationWarning[]; autoFixes: AutoFix[]; constraintsChecked: number; executionTime: number; } export interface ValidationError { rule: string; field?: string; message: string; severity: 'error' | 'warning'; constraint: string; suggestedFix?: string; blockExecution: boolean; } export interface ValidationWarning { rule: string; field?: string; message: string; impact: 'low' | 'medium' | 'high'; recommendation: string; } export interface AutoFix { rule: string; field: string; originalValue: any; fixedValue: any; strategy: string; applied: boolean; } export declare class ConstraintValidator { private client; private validationRules; private schemaInfo; constructor(client: SupabaseClient); /** * Initialize validator with schema information and build validation rules */ initialize(schemaInfo: SchemaIntrospectionResult): Promise<void>; /** * Validate data against all applicable constraints before operation */ validateOperation(context: ValidationContext): Promise<ValidationResult>; /** * Apply auto-fixes to data before operation */ applyAutoFixes(data: Record<string, any>, autoFixes: AutoFix[]): Promise<{ data: Record<string, any>; appliedFixes: AutoFix[]; }>; /** * Build validation rules from schema constraints */ private buildValidationRules; /** * Build validation rules from database constraints */ private buildConstraintRules; /** * Build NOT NULL constraint rules */ private buildNotNullRules; /** * Build UNIQUE constraint rules */ private buildUniqueRules; /** * Build FOREIGN KEY constraint rules */ private buildForeignKeyRules; /** * Build CHECK constraint rules */ private buildCheckConstraintRules; /** * Build business logic constraint rules */ private buildBusinessLogicRules; /** * Build pattern-based validation rules */ private buildPatternRules; /** * Build user table specific rules */ private buildUserTableRules; /** * Execute a single validation rule */ private executeValidationRule; /** * Validate NOT NULL constraint */ private validateNotNull; /** * Validate UNIQUE constraint */ private validateUnique; /** * Validate FOREIGN KEY constraint */ private validateForeignKey; /** * Validate CHECK constraint */ private validateCheckConstraint; /** * Validate business logic constraint */ private validateBusinessLogic; /** * Validate custom rule */ private validateCustomRule; /** * Utility methods */ private getDefaultValueForColumn; private getTotalRuleCount; /** * Get validation rules for a specific table */ getTableRules(tableName: string): ValidationRule[]; /** * Get all validation rules */ getAllRules(): Map<string, ValidationRule[]>; /** * Clear validation cache */ clearCache(): void; } export {}; //# sourceMappingURL=constraint-validator.d.ts.map
